  • Description
    Purified mouse monoclonal antibody 16F6 that binds to a conformation epitope on Sudan virus (SUDV) glycoprotein (GP). This antibody demonstrates protection against SUDV both in vitro and in vivo (Dias et al., 2011 Nov 20, Nat Struct Mol Biol. 18 (12): 1424-1427).

  • Immunogen
    Venezuelan equine encephalitis virus replicons encoding SUDV GP and gamma-radiationinactivated SUDV-Boniface were used to generate the original mouse monoclonal antibody.
